The right way to Find a Realtor You Can Trust
Discovering a realtor you can trust is essential to navigating the complex world of real estate, whether or not you're buying or selling a property. A reliable realtor not only facilitates the transaction but in addition ensures that your interests are well-protected. Right here’s a complete guide on how one can discover a trustworthy realtor.
Research and Referrals
Start by asking friends, family, and colleagues for referrals. Personal suggestions are often the best way to find a trustworthy realtor. Individuals you know are likely to provide you trustworthy feedback about their experiences.
Additionally, conduct on-line research. Look for realtors with robust on-line presence and positive opinions on platforms like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Google Reviews. Be cautious of evaluations that are excessively positive without specifics, as they is perhaps less genuine.
Check Credentials and Licensing
Ensure the realtor is licensed and in good standing with local real estate boards. In the United States, you can confirm this information by means of the state’s real estate fee or regulatory body. A licensed realtor has undergone the necessary training and adheres to the ethical guidelines set by the industry.
Look for realtors who are members of the National Association of Realtors (NAR). Realtors with this membership adhere to a strict code of ethics, which is an efficient indicator of professionalism and reliability.
Expertise and Expertise
Experience issues significantly in real estate. An skilled realtor is more likely to understand market traits, negotiate successfully, and handle complex transactions smoothly. Look for someone who has been in the industry for a number of years and has a powerful track record in your specific area.
Ask potential realtors about their expertise in your neighborhood or with the type of property you have an interest in. A realtor with local experience will have valuable insights into market conditions, pricing, and potential challenges.
Interview Multiple Realtors
Don’t settle for the first realtor you meet. Interview multiple candidates to match their approaches, experience, and personalities. Prepare a list of questions to ask, corresponding to:
How lengthy have you ever been in real estate?
What's your experience in this specific market?
Can you provide references from past clients?
How do you propose to market my property or find a property for me?
What is your fee structure?
Pay attention to their communication fashion and responsiveness. A superb realtor must be a wonderful communicator, keeping you informed at every step of the process.
Consider Their Network
A well-related realtor may be an asset. Realtors with extensive networks can provide access to a wide range of companies, including mortgage brokers, house inspectors, contractors, and attorneys. This can simplify the buying or selling process and ensure you get the most effective providers at competitive rates.
Trust Your Instincts
Trust your gut feeling when choosing a realtor. If something doesn’t really feel proper, it’s okay to walk away. You must really feel comfortable and confident in your realtor’s abilities and ethics. A trustworthy realtor will be transparent, sincere, and dedicated to your best interests.
Red Flags to Watch For
Be wary of realtors who:
Pressure you into choices or make you're feeling uncomfortable.
Lack knowledge in regards to the native market or appear disinterested in your needs.
Have poor communication skills or are regularly unavailable.
Offer offers that appear too good to be true.
Avoid answering your questions or providing detailed information.
Utilize Technology
Many modern realtors make the most of technology to boost their services. Look for realtors who use online marketing, virtual excursions, and digital document signing. These instruments can make the process more efficient and convenient for you.
Conclusion
Discovering a realtor you can trust requires effort and time, but it’s an funding that can save you stress and money within the long run. By conducting thorough research, verifying credentials, evaluating expertise, interviewing multiple candidates, and trusting your instincts, you could find a reliable realtor who will guide you thru the real estate process with integrity and professionalism. Bear in mind, the precise realtor is not just a service provider but a partner in your real estate journey.
